Joe Dean Mills went home to be with his Lord Monday, March 12, 2018. He was given the gift of life in Enid, Oklahoma by Ruby Jewell Jantz Mills and Mayor Eugene Mills on March 20, 1938.

Joe attended Oklahoma State University and graduated with a degree in Business. It is while attending college that he met the love of his life, Kay Herron, and married her on August 17, 1963. Joe was told by a brother-in-law that “You are not just marrying a woman, but a whole family,” and what a family he got.

He served his country by enlisting in the United States Navy, April 16, 1962 and served until April 15, 1964.

Joe worked for “Back to the Bible Broadcast” in Lincoln, Nebraska for 40 years. He and Kay settled back into McCurtain County in 2005. He was a member of the First Baptist Church and loved to listen to music and piano solos.

He was preceded in death by his parents, Ruby and Eugene Mills; brother, Miles Mills; and mother and father-in-law, Joe and Evelyn Herron.

Joe is survived by his wife of 54 years Kay Herron Mills; children, Dr. Jeffrey D. Mills and wife, Sandra of Palmdale, California, Heather Kroll and husband, K.C. of Castle Pines, Colorado; grandchildren, Alex Mills, Nick Mills, Lincoln Kroll, Atlas Kroll; family by love, Darrell and Kathie Whitten of McKinney, Texas, Bill and JoAnn Smith of Rogers, Arkansas, Larry and Judy Massey of Ponca City, Oklahoma, Billy and Susan Gentry of Hobart, Oklahoma, Mike and Brenda Palmer of Idabel, Oklahoma, Dennis and Nancy Watson of Miami, Oklahoma, Dr. Bill and Kim Herron of Idabel, Don and Mary Herron of Idabel, Oklahoma, Jan Herron and Gama Leyva of Arizona; many other family members and friends.

There are so many family members and friends that will think of Joe with fond memories and the cousins will always talk about the stories and memories, especially the time he rode his bicycle from Lincoln, Nebraska to Idabel. We still remember and marvel!

Keep those streets busy and “Ride On, Bicycle Man…..” We’ll see you again one day.

A celebration of life service will be 2:00 p.m. Saturday, March 17, 2018 at the First Baptist Church in Idabel with Bro. Andy Bowman officiating. Interment will follow in the Denison Cemetery.
